M.Herweg 10.12.1997 quota.html
Quota auf Suse Linux 5.1
1.) Kernel kompilieren:mit quota-Support
2.) ins Wurzelverzeichnis eines jeden Laufwerks die Datei quota.user anlegen
touch quota.user
chmod 600 quota.user
3.)in /etc/fstab
zB:alt:
/dev/hda1 / ext2 defaults 1 1
neu:
/dev/hda1 / ext2 defaults,usrquota 1 1
4.)reboot
5.)quotaon -a
7.)edquota -t (bei Bedarf: graceperiod einstellen)
8.)edquota <user1> <user2> ... (quota für user einstellen, 1Block=1kByte)
9.) edquota -p <puser> <user1> <user2> ... ... (quota für user1 & 2 soll gleich sein wie quota von puser)
10.)quotacheck -a (auch nach jedem unsauberen herunterfahren)
11.) quotaoff -a
12.)start und stopskripte (sbin/init.d)editieren oder neue anlegen
start: qouotaon -a
stop: quotaoff -a
13.) reboot
quota -zeigt dem user an, wieviel er belegt & belegen darf
repquota [-v] /dev/hda1 - zeigt die Belegung der Platte nach usern aufgelistet
Vorsicht!!!
repquota -a fürte dazu, dass der prozess repquota -a sich nicht mehr killen liess, auch nicht mit -9 !!